1. Christian Cage

Christian cage bryan danielson roh

When Christian got fed up of bashing his head on WWE’s glass ceiling and elected to let his contract expire at the close of 2005, he did so in the knowledge that he was betting on himself to prove his worth elsewhere. 

He quickly settled in TNA but, like many others who were employed by Dixie Carter and co., Captain Charisma supplemented his income by working at the weekends for anyone who would meet his asking price. 

One company willing to stump up the funds was Ring of Honor, who brought Christian in for a couple of shots in May and July of 2006. 

In the first, he teamed with Colt Cabana to defeat Bryan Danielson and Christopher Daniels in the long main event of the How We Roll show, where he didn’t look out of place at all, despite being used to working shorter matches in a much different style. 

Him hitting the Killswitch on the Fallen Angel set up a natural singles match with Daniels at the Generation Now event. He returned the favour, too, again putting a shift in and working hard to get his opponent and the match over, before getting pinned clean in the middle with the Angel’s Wings.
